Why the Wealth Gap Exists for Black Women
-
The Income vs. Wealth Disparity
High salaries don’t always translate to wealth. Black women are outpacing many demographics in earnings but still face limited access to wealth-building tools, networks, and investment opportunities. -
Lack of Generational Wealth Transfer
Many Black women are starting from scratch, without the financial head start of inherited wealth, real estate, or trust funds—things that give other communities a significant advantage. -
Cultural Pressures & Financial Responsibility
The expectation to support family and community often puts Black women in a position where they are building for themselves while also being financial safety nets for others.
How to Break the Cycle & Build Real Wealth
✔ Shift from Earned Income to Asset-Building – Prioritize investments, real estate, and wealth protection over excessive spending.
✔ Invest Like the Wealthy Do – Learn how to navigate the stock market, build a portfolio, and make your money work for you.
✔ Develop Wealth Etiquette & Strategic Networking – Understanding how to move in high-value spaces is just as important as financial literacy.
